Oracle 11g 上安装ASM(RHEL5)

1、Oracle 11g安装

详细过程请参考:

http://blog.sina.com.cn/s/blog_7c5a82970101excf.html

 和10g不同,11g中如果要单机使用asm需要安装grid frastructure组件
安装软件就在grid包中,安装时选择第二个选项就能进入这个组件的安装

2、安装Oracleasm软件包

rpm -ivh oracleasm-support-2.1.7-1.el5.x86_64.rpm oracleasmlib-2.0.4-1.el5.x86_64.rpm oracleasm-2.6.18-164.el5-2.0.5-1.el5.x86_64.rpm

一共三个

下载位置:

http://www.oracle.com/technetwork/server-storage/linux/downloads/rhel5-084877.html

 

3、配置oracleasm并安装磁盘组

/etc/init.d/oracleasm configure

/etc/init.d/oracleasm createdisk V1 /dev/sdb1

/etc/init.d/oracleasm createdisk V2 /dev/sdc1

 

4、安装Oracle Grid Infrastructure

(1) 配置grid用户

 

 

vim /etc/security/limits.conf
------------------------------------------
#Oracle configure shell parameters
oracle soft nofile 65536
oracle hard nofile 65536
oracle soft nproc 16384
oracle hard nproc 16384

grid soft nofile 65536
grid hard nofile 65536
grid soft nproc 16384
grid hard nproc 16384

 

vim /home/grid/.bashrc

 

export ORACLE_HOME=/u01/app/11.2.0/grid

export PATH=$ORACLE_HOME/bin:$PATH

export ORACLE_OWNER=oracle

export ORACLE_SID=+ASM

export LD_LIBRARY_PATH=$ORACLE_HOME/lib:$LD_LIBRARY_PATH

export PATH=$ORACLE_HOME/bin:$PATH

export LANG=en_US

alias sqlplus='rlwrap sqlplus'

alias lsnrctl='rlwrap lsnrctl'

alias asmcmd='rlwrap asmcmd'

 

(2) oracle和grid用户分别要属于相应的用户组

useradd -g oinstall -G dba,oper,asmdba,asmadmin oracle

useradd -g oinstall -G dba,asmadmin,asmdba,asmoper grid

 

(3) 安装软件

./runInstaller

选择Install and Configure Gride Infrastructure for a Standalone Server

 

(4)指定磁盘位置

/dev/oracleasm/disks

 

5、使用dbca创建基于ASM的实例

 

注意:

一定要让oracle在oinstall和asmadmin组和asmdba中,否则在oracle用户下创建数据库会无法识别oracleasm磁盘组

如果出现asmca needs oracle grid infrastructure to configure asm的错误。那一般是因为在单节点安装grid出现的常见问题,一种方法是重新运行一次grid下面的runInstaller(不推荐)。

还有一种方法是安装后执行一个Perl脚本/u01/app/grid/product/11.2.0/grid/perl/bin/perl -I /u01/app/grid/product/11.2.0/grid/perl/lib/ -I /u01/app/11.2.0/grid/crs/install /u01/app/11.2.0/grid/crs/install/roothas.pl 

这样就可以了。

转载于:https://www.cnblogs.com/taowang2016/p/3365553.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值